Automated Guided Vehicle management serves as the central nervous system for warehouse automation hardware coordination within modern logistics centers. This module oversees movement protocols and spatial allocation to ensure that all physical assets navigate safely while maximizing throughput capacity during peak operational windows without human intervention failure. Fleet operators require precise direction regarding vehicle paths, battery recharging schedules, and task assignment prioritization to maintain continuous workflow integrity.
Real-time telemetry provides visibility into equipment status, preventing collisions and identifying maintenance needs before critical failures impact inventory processing rates significantly. Integration with upstream storage systems ensures that inventory levels update immediately upon successful drop-off or pick confirmation events.

initiate fleet request from wms inventory system for task assignment
calculate optimal routing based on current zone congestion data points
direct autonomous vehicles to dispatch location via wireless communications channel
monitor battery status and suggest recharging stops before failure occurs
Efficient AGV management enhances warehouse throughput by reducing manual dispatch times and optimizing route efficiency across the entire facility footprint. The system minimizes human interaction risks while maintaining strict control over autonomous asset movements throughout all operational shifts continuously. Dynamic traffic management prevents congestion points that could delay critical inventory processing tasks or disrupt workflow continuity for downstream teams involved in picking activities.
